Recreation Vehicle and Special
Body or Equipment Alterations
Installations or alterations to the
original equipment vehicle or
chassis, as manufactured and
assembled by Cadillac, are not
covered by this warranty. The special body company, assembler,
or equipment installer is solely
responsible for warranties on the
body or equipment and any
alterations to any of the parts,
components, systems,
or assemblies installed by Cadillac.
Examples include, but are not
limited to, special body installations,
such as recreational vehicles, the
installation of any non-GM part,
cutting, welding, or the
disconnecting of original equipment
vehicle or chassis parts and
components, extension of the
wheelbase, suspension and
driveline modifications, and axle
additions.
Pre-Delivery Service
Defects in the mechanical,
electrical, sheet metal, paint, trim,
and other components of your
vehicle may occur at the factory or
while it is being transported to the
dealer facility. Normally, any defects
occurring during assembly are
identified and corrected at the
factory during the inspection
process. In addition, dealers inspect
each vehicle before delivery. They
repair any uncorrected factory
defects and any transit damage
detected before the vehicle is
delivered to you.
Any defects still present at the time
the vehicle is delivered to you are
covered by the warranty. If you find
any defects, advise your dealer
without delay. For further details
concerning any repairs which the
dealer may have made prior to you
taking delivery of your vehicle, ask
your dealer.
Production Changes
Cadillac and Cadillac dealers
reserve the right to make changes
in vehicles built and/or sold by them
at any time without incurring any
obligation to make the same or
similar changes on vehicles
previously built and/or sold by them.

Noise Emissions Warranty for
Light Duty Trucks Over
10,000 Lbs Gross Vehicle
Weight Rating (GVWR) Only
GM warrants to the first person who
purchases this vehicle for purposes
other than resale and to each
subsequent purchaser of this
vehicle, as manufactured by GM,
that this vehicle was designed, built,
and equipped to conform at the time
it left GM's control with all applicable
United States EPA Noise Control
Regulations.
This warranty covers this vehicle as
designed, built, and equipped by
GM, and is not limited to any
particular part, component,
or system of the vehicle
manufactured by GM. Defects in
design, or assembly, or in any part,
component, or vehicle system as
manufactured by GM, which, at the
time it left GM's control, caused
noise emissions to exceed Federal
Standards, are covered by this
warranty for the life of the vehicle.

18 Emission Control Systems Warranty
The emission warranty on your
vehicle is issued in accordance with
the U.S. Federal Clean Air Act.
Defects in material or workmanship
in GM emission parts may also be
covered under the New Vehicle
Limited Warranty
Bumper-to-Bumper coverage.
What Is Covered
The parts covered under the
emission warranty are listed under
the“Emission Warranty Parts List”
later in this section.
How to Determine the
Applicable Emissions Control
System Warranty
State and Federal agencies may
require a different emission control
system warranty depending on:
. Whether the vehicle conforms to
regulations applicable to light
duty or heavy duty emission
control systems.
. Whether the vehicle conforms to
or is certified for California
regulations in addition to U.S.
EPA Federal regulations. All vehicles are eligible for Federal
Emissions Control System Warranty
Coverage. If the emissions control
label contains language stating the
vehicle conforms to California
regulations, the vehicle is also
eligible for California Emissions
Control System Warranty Coverage.
Federal Emission Control
System Warranty
Federal Warranty Coverage
.
Car or Light Duty Truck with a
Gross Vehicle Weight
Rating (GVWR) of 8,500 lbs.
or less
‐2 years or 24,000 miles and
8 years or 80,000 miles for the
catalytic converter, vehicle/
powertrain control module,
transmission control module or
other onboard emissions
diagnostic device, including
emission-related software,
whichever comes first. .
Light Duty Truck equipped with
Heavy Duty Gasoline Engine
and with a Gross Vehicle Weight
Rating (GVWR) greater than
8,500 lbs.
‐5 years or 50,000 miles,
whichever comes first.
. Light Duty Truck equipped with
Heavy Duty Diesel Engine and
with a Gross Vehicle Weight
Rating (GVWR) greater than
8,500 lbs.
‐5 years or 50,000 miles,
whichever comes first.
Federal Emission Defect Warranty
GM warrants to the owner the
following:
. The vehicle was designed,
equipped, and built so as to
conform at the time of sale with
applicable regulations of the
Federal Environmental
Protection Agency (EPA).
. The vehicle is free from defects
in materials and workmanship
which cause the vehicle to fail to

conform with those regulations
during the emission warranty
period.
Emission-related defects in the
genuine GM parts listed under the
Emission Warranty Parts List,
including related diagnostic costs,
parts, and labor are covered by this
warranty.
Federal Emission Performance
Warranty
Some states and/or local
jurisdictions have established
periodic vehicle Inspection and
Maintenance (I/M) programs to
encourage proper maintenance of
your vehicle. If an EPA-approved I/
M program is enforced in your area,
you may also be eligible for
Emission Performance Warranty
coverage when all three of the
following conditions are met:
. The vehicle has been
maintained and operated in
accordance with the instructions
for proper maintenance and use
set forth in the owner manual
supplied with your vehicle. .
The vehicle fails an
EPA-approved I/M test during
the emission warranty period.
. The failure results, or will result,
in the owner of the vehicle
having to bear a penalty or other
sanctions, including the denial of
the right to use the vehicle,
under local, state, or federal law.
GM warrants that your Cadillac
dealer will replace, repair, or adjust
to Cadillac specifications, at no
charge to you, any of the parts listed
under Emission Warranty Parts List
0 22, which may be necessary to
conform to the applicable emission
standards. Non-Cadillac parts
labeled “Certified to EPA Standards”
are covered by the Federal
Emission Performance Warranty.
California Emission Control
System Warranty
This section outlines the emission
warranty that Cadillac provides for
your vehicle in accordance with the
California Air Resources Board.
Defects in material or workmanship
in Cadillac emission parts may also be covered under the New Vehicle
Limited Warranty
Bumper-to-Bumper coverage.
This warranty applies if your vehicle
meets both of the following
requirements:
.
Your vehicle is registered in
California or other states
adopting California emission
and warranty regulations.*
. Your vehicle is certified for sale
in California as indicated on the
vehicle's emission control
information label.
* Important: Connecticut,
Delaware, Maine, Maryland,
Massachusetts, New Jersey, New
York, Oregon, Pennsylvania, Rhode
Island, Vermont, and Washington
have California Emissions Warranty
coverage.
California Partial Zero Emission
Vehicles (PZEV) have extended
coverage on all emission-related
parts.
Important: California, Connecticut,
Maine, Maryland, Massachusetts,
New Jersey, New York, Rhode

Your Rights and Obligations (For
Vehicles Subject to California
Exhaust Emission Standards)
The California Air Resources Board
and General Motors are pleased to
explain the emission control system
warranty on your vehicle. In
California, new motor vehicles must
be designed, built, and equipped to
meet the state's stringent anti-smog
standards. Cadillac must warrant
the emission control system on your
vehicle for the periods of time and
mileage listed provided there has
been no abuse, neglect, or improper
maintenance of your vehicle. Your
vehicle's emission control system
may include parts such as the fuel
injection system, ignition system,
catalytic converter, and engine
computer. Also included are hoses,
belts, connectors, and other
emission-related assemblies.Where a warrantable condition
exists, Cadillac will repair your
vehicle at no cost to you including
diagnosis, parts, and labor.
California Emission Defect and
Emission Performance Warranty
Coverage
For cars and trucks with light duty or
medium duty emissions:
.
For 3 years or 50,000 miles,
whichever comes first:
‐If your vehicle fails a smog
check inspection, Cadillac will
make all necessary repairs
and adjustments to ensure
that your vehicle passes the
inspection. This is your
Emission Control System
Performance Warranty.
‐ If any emission-related part on
your vehicle is defective,
Cadillac will repair or replace
it. This is your Short-term
Emission Control Systems
Defects Warranty. .
For 7 years or 70,000 miles,
whichever comes first:
‐If an emission-related part
listed in this booklet specially
noted with coverage for
7 years or 70,000 miles is
defective, Cadillac will repair
or replace it. This is your
Long-term Emission Control
System Defects Warranty.
. For 8 years or 80,000 miles,
whichever comes first:
‐If the catalytic converter,
vehicle/powertrain control
module, transmission control
module, or other onboard
emissions diagnostic device,
including emissions-related
software, is found to be
defective, Cadillac will repair
or replace it under the Federal
Emission Control System
Warranty.

.For 15 years or 150,000 miles,
whichever comes first for a
Partial Zero Emission
Vehicle (PZEV):
‐If any emission-related part*
listed in this booklet is
defective, Cadillac will repair
or replace it. This is your
(PZEV) Emission Control
System Defects Warranty.
* PZEV Hybrid Batteries and Hybrid
A/C Compressors are covered for
10 years or 150,000 miles,
whichever comes first.
Any authorized Cadillac dealer will,
as necessary under these
warranties, replace, repair, or adjust
to GM specifications any genuine
GM parts that affect emissions.
The applicable warranty period shall
begin on the date the vehicle is
delivered to the first retail purchaser or, if the vehicle is first placed in
service as a demonstrator or
company vehicle prior to sale at
retail, on the date the vehicle is
placed in such service.
Owner's Warranty Responsibilities
As the vehicle owner, you are
responsible for the performance of
the scheduled maintenance listed in
your owner manual. GM
recommends that you retain all
maintenance receipts for your
vehicle, but GM cannot deny
warranty coverage solely for the
lack of receipts or for your failure to
ensure the performance of all
scheduled maintenance.
You are responsible for presenting
your vehicle to a GM dealer selling
your vehicle line as soon as a
problem exists. The warranted
repairs should be completed in a
reasonable amount of time, not to
exceed 30 days.
As the vehicle owner, you should
also be aware that GM may deny
warranty coverage if your vehicle or
a part has failed due to abuse,
neglect, improper or insufficient
maintenance, or modifications not
approved by GM.

Parts specified in your maintenance
schedule that require scheduled
replacement are covered up to their
first replacement interval or the
applicable emission warranty
coverage period, whichever comes
first. If failure of one of these parts
results in failure of another part,
both will be covered under the
Emission Control System Warranty.

Replacement Parts
The emission control systems of
your vehicle were designed, built,
and tested using genuine GM parts*
and the vehicle is certified as being
in conformity with applicable federal
and California emission
requirements.
Accordingly, it is
recommended that any
replacement parts used for maintenance or for the repair of
emission control systems be new,
genuine GM parts.
The warranty obligations are not
dependent upon the use of any
particular brand of replacement
parts. The owner may elect to use
non-genuine GM parts for
replacement purposes. Use of
replacement parts which are not of
equivalent quality may impair the
effectiveness of emission control
systems.
If other than new, genuine GM parts
are used for maintenance
replacements or for the repair of
parts affecting emission control, the
owner should assure himself/herself
that such parts are warranted by
their manufacturer to be equivalent
to genuine GM parts in performance
and durability.
